Transaction 416ff5959bd14ab3f70455bbb470a1e1b69ca5001f66ba082a559ecf066dbf91

1 Input
1 Outputs
  • 416ff5959bd14ab3f70455bbb470a1e1b69ca5001f66ba082a559ecf066dbf91:0
  • value  346042
    address  3CaiEiKEhFAtoJEfT6tjpRgCTLQCXyiyBH